  • Patent number: 12671595
    Abstract: Implementation(s) for acquiring new certificates on behalf of managed endpoints. For example, new certificates are acquired by: identifying a managed endpoint associated with a current certificate and corresponding current private key to be renewed; sending a first one or more messages to the managed endpoint to cause the managed endpoint to generate information needed to acquire a new certificate; providing the information to a certificate authority (CA) and receiving a corresponding new certificate from the CA on behalf of the managed endpoint; and sending one or more messages to the managed endpoint to replace the current certificate and current private key with the new certificate and a new private key, respectively.

  • Patent number: 12623778
    Abstract: The present disclosure relates to a secondary airfoil apparatus, system and method for improving lift, takeoff, landing and aerodynamic performance of a floatplane. The secondary airfoil is itself of sufficient structural rigidity to withstand any and all forces added by the airfoil during floatplane operation, and is fixedly attached between the floats of the floatplane. The secondary airfoil can be arranged at an optimal angle of incidence and vertical lift position relative to the primary airfoil, or wing of the aircraft, and relative to the floats center of gravity and drag for optimal maneuverability of the floatplane.

  • Patent number: 12540701
    Abstract: An expansion joint is formed from a plurality of layers comprising a ring tie-in ply, a pair of arch rings at opposing transition points, two body plies, with inverted bias cut angles between about 48° to 60°, where about is typically plus or minus 1 degree. The arch geometry is such that the arch has an axial length C between the transition points and an inner surface arch circumference length of A between the transition points in a neutral state, such that the maximum compression distance for the expansion joint is the length C, the maximum elongation distance for the expansion joint is a length (A?C), and a maximum lateral deflection length for the expansion joint is a length Y.

  • Patent number: 12186690
    Abstract: A substrate for use in an aqueous slurry has a polymeric coating to provide a compliant and sticky surface. The polymer coating has a chemical to render the surface hydrophobic so as to attract hydrophobic or hydrophobized mineral particles in the slurry. The substrate can take the form of a conveyor belt, a bead, a mesh, an impeller, a filter or a flat surface. The substrate can also be an open-cell foam. The polymeric coating can be modified with tackifiers; plasticizers; crosslinking agents; chain transfer agents; chain extenders; adhesion promoters; aryl or alky copolymers; fluorinated copolymers and/or additives; hydrophobicizing agents such as hexamethyldisilazane; inorganic particles such as silica, hydrophobic silica, and/or fumed hydrophobic silica; MQ resin; and/or other additives to control and modify the properties of the polymer.
